Holiday Package Service

The Sachse Police Department is excited to offer the police department as a package delivery site for its residents until December 22. In an effort to combat package theft, citizens who would normally have packages delivered to their residence may opt to have the packages delivered to the Sachse Police Department instead. A representative of the police department will accept packages and secure them until residents are able to pick up items.


To pick-up packages, residents must provide government issued identification. If package is address to a child, parents must provide proof of guardianship or child identification. 


The Sachse Police Department is not responsible for any damaged packages delivered to the department.


There is no charge for this service and it is available to all Sachse residents.

Groundbreaking Ceremony for
Evolve Biologics

A groundbreaking ceremony took place this past Wednesday, December 8, where we were  able to officially welcome Evolve Biologics to Sachse! Evolve Biologics Inc., an innovative plasma-derived therapeutics company, announced earlier this week the site selection, land purchase and groundbreaking ceremony for its new manufacturing facility. 


This state-of-the-art facility will be the first to use Evolve’s innovative and proprietary technology, PlasmaCap EBA®, to commercially produce plasma-derived therapeutics, initially Intravenous Immunoglobulin (IVIG) and Human Serum Albumin (HSA).

When construction is completed, Evolve Biologics will employ over 300 workers at this new facility. If you would like to learn more about what Evolve Biologics does, visit: https://www.evolvebiologics.com/about.

Discover Your Bulk & Brush Collection Day

The City has new times to set out your bulk trash and brush collection. Bulk trash needs to be placed out no earlier than 48 hours prior to your scheduled collection day. What about brush? It goes out on the Saturday prior to your collection day.

Please Note: no more than 6 cubic yards of brush/bulk are allowed to be out on the curb at one time. 


Not sure about your collection day? Check the interactive map on our bulk trash webpage: www.cityofsachse.com/bulktrash. You'll find information about what is considered bulk trash and the items included in brush.
